Customers can manage their savings online thanks to the TD ePremium Savings Account and digital savings account that TD Bank offers. It provides a convenient and secure platform for individuals looking to grow their money while maintaining easy access to their funds.
Basically, the TD ePremium Savings Account allows you to earn 1.6% interest on balances over $10,000. But you won’t be charged any interest if your balance drops below that threshold. It also lets you move money between other TD bank accounts for free and without limits.

TD ePremium Savings Account features
When opening this savings account, you’ll have access to these great features:
- No monthly fees: You won’t be charged a monthly fee to maintain and use this account.
- Earn interest on your savings: For balances over $10,000, you can earn a competitive interest rate of 1.6%.
- No minimum deposits: You don’t have to retain any specific amount in your account to keep it open.
- Free and unlimited online transfer
- Unlimited transfers to other TD accounts: There are no fees or restrictions on moving money between your TD accounts.

Cons of the TD ePremium Savings Account
No Interest Below $10,000
The ePremium Savings Account does not pay interest on balances under $10,000, a significant drawback. Even if your account falls short by just $1, you won’t receive any interest on the balance.
Transaction Fees
Unlike other savings accounts, the ePremium Savings Account does not offer free debits for transactions, except for internal transfers between TD accounts. Each time you dip into your savings and withdraw or transfer to an external account, you incur a $5 transaction fee.
ABM Fees
Additional charges apply for withdrawals from the ePremium Savings Account when using non-TD ABMs. These fees are $2 per transaction at non-TD ABMs and $3 and $5 at US, Mexican, and foreign ABMs, respectively.
TD ePremium Savings Account fees
No monthly fee is associated with the account, making it an attractive choice for those seeking to avoid recurring charges. But it’s important to remember that there are transaction fees.
Each transaction costs $5.00. This fee applies to withdrawals or transfers made from the account, except for free online transfers, which are unlimited.
Additionally, when using non-TD ABMs within Canada, a fee of $2.00 is charged per transaction. For ePremium Savings Account holders who need to withdraw money while travelling in the United States or Mexico, a foreign ABM fee of $3.00 is applicable for each transaction.
A higher foreign ABM fee of $5.00 is imposed per transaction for withdrawals made in any other foreign country.
Other TD Bank account options
TD Bank also offers the TD Unlimited Chequing Account. It’s a common choice for people with high transaction volumes. With this account, you can enjoy unlimited transactions, including withdrawals, debit purchases, bill payments, and online transfers, without worrying about transaction fees.
Those who want their savings to grow while being easily accessible can open a TD Every Day Savings Account. It offers competitive interest rates on your savings balance. And it allows unlimited online transfers between your TD accounts at no additional cost.
How to open a TD ePremium Savings Account
- Visit TD’s website and select “Bank Accounts” under the “Products” tab.
- Choose “Savings accounts” and click on the TD ePremium Savings Account.
- Enter personal information like name, date of birth, SIN, employment, and email.
- Review the details and apply.
Eligibility Requirements
- At least 18 years old (or 19, in some jurisdictions) and a Canadian citizen or permanent resident to apply.
- Open a sole account in your name.
Required Documents and Information:
- Name, residential status, and contact details
- Optional SIN and DOB
- Valid phone number and email address.
